SAN FRANCISCO - Californer -- A Hot Set is excited to introduce Kirk Navarro as the new Editor-In-Chief. A great addition to A.N. Publishing's staff, Navarro is set to assume the role on May 16, 2022.
Navarro has collected an array of editorial experiences starting in 2016 when he worked with Grace Hsu as a freelance editor for two years. Next, he assumed the role of a Writer at Awesome Totally Awesome. The media platform provided him with the opportunity to develop topics and draft articles independently. In 2019 Navarro worked for Gamers Decide where he further honed his editing skills before eventually becoming an Editorial intern at Discover GREY in 2020.

Navarro's ascension to Editor will with no doubt afford him the opportunity to display his editorial prowess. Founder and publisher of A Hot Set, David Nole, looks forward to his future contributions.
"Kirk has an extensive background as a writer and editor. His skills and editorial leadership experience will help to shape A Hot Set's content."
http://www.AHotSet.com is an entertainment trade publication focused on people of color in film, television, gaming, web series and theater sectors.
